Handover note — Crumbwheel order cutoffs.

Welcome aboard. The bakery cutoff rule in Crumbwheel closes same-day orders at 14:00 local to each storefront, not UTC — this has bitten us twice. Holiday overrides live in the calendar service and take precedence silently, so always check there first when a cutoff looks wrong. To unlock the calendar service's admin console after a restart, enter the recovery passphrase below.

vault phrase of bagap-bahaf = silion-pelox-sorox-casdor-quenwyn-fraax-eliox-praael-kelion-quenvan-kasox-rusael-norius-belvan

## Service Accounts — StormFan Alert Fan-Out

The fan-out worker authenticates to the internal dispatch tier using the svc-stormfan account. Rotate quarterly; scopes are limited to publish-only on alert topics. If deliveries stall during your shift, verify the worker is using the current credential, reproduced below for reference.

API key for kaweg-hahif: kto4_rAjZ

## 3.8.2 — Cold start trims

Shaved cold starts on the Lanternjar serverless handlers by about 40%. Main tricks: lazy-loading the PDF renderer, pre-warming the config cache at build time, and dropping two chunky transitive deps. Watch for the new init hook in handlers/bootstrap.ts — that's the risky bit for review. Benchmarks are in the perf/ folder. The person who owns this change is named below.

account owner for bawip-tahag: Raleth Quenok

MEETING NOTES (excerpt) — Thornlake Reservoir Samples

Present: dispatch desk leads, lab liaison. The weekly water samples from Thornlake Reservoir must now reach the Calbright testing lab within six hours of draw, chilled and logged at both ends. Gullwing Couriers holds the contract; their rider carries an insulated case marked for the lab. Dispatch confirms draw time on the chit before release. At hand-over, dispatch must state this instruction to the rider:

dispatch memo: the quenax olidor courier leaves the lamvan aldath keliel ledger at gate 2085 under passcode 005795